The most common reasons a 2022 Subaru Ascent speedometer isn't working are the vehicle speed sensor (VSS), a faulty speedometer, or an electrical issue.
  • Vehicle Speed Sensor (VSS): A faulty vehicle speed sensor can result in inaccurate speed readings and erratic transmission shifting.
  • Speedometer: A faulty speed sensor or a broken connection in the speedometer circuit can result in inaccurate speed readings.
  • Electrical Issue: A blown fuse or a short circuit in the wiring can cause various electrical issues in the vehicle's systems.

What are the steps to diagnose a non-functioning speedometer in a 2022 Subaru Ascent?

To diagnose a non-functioning speedometer in your 2022 Subaru Ascent, begin with the simplest solution by checking the fuse associated with the speedometer in the fuse box, as a blown fuse can easily disrupt its operation. If the fuse is intact, proceed to inspect the speed sensor, which is crucial for relaying speed data to the speedometer; any signs of damage or malfunction here could be the culprit. Next, examine the wiring connections for any loose or corroded wires that might hinder the signal transmission. If these preliminary checks do not resolve the issue, utilize a diagnostic tool to test the speedometer cluster for internal faults, which can help determine if the problem lies within the speedometer itself. Finally, ensure that the vehicle is receiving a speed signal from the transmission or ABS system, as a lack of this signal can also lead to speedometer failure. By following this structured approach, you can effectively identify and address the root cause of your speedometer issues.

What are the common problems that could cause the speedometer to stop working in a 2022 Subaru Ascent?

When the speedometer in your 2022 Subaru Ascent stops functioning, it can be frustrating, but understanding the common problems can help you diagnose the issue. One of the primary culprits is a faulty vehicle speed sensor, which is responsible for relaying speed information to the speedometer. If this sensor malfunctions, you may experience erratic readings or a complete failure of the speedometer. Another potential issue is a broken speedometer cable; if this cable is damaged, it can disrupt the connection needed for accurate speed display. Additionally, a blown fuse in the instrument panel can lead to a non-operational speedometer, so checking the fuses is a good first step. Problems within the instrument cluster itself, such as wiring issues or a malfunctioning gauge, can also prevent the speedometer from working correctly. Lastly, a defective speedometer head may be the reason for the failure. While some of these issues can be diagnosed and potentially fixed at home, it is advisable to consult a qualified mechanic for a thorough inspection and repair to ensure your speedometer operates accurately and reliably.

How urgent is it to address the non-functioning speedometer in a 2022 Subaru Ascent?

Addressing a non-functioning speedometer in your 2022 Subaru Ascent is not just a matter of convenience; it is an urgent necessity. Ignoring this issue can lead to serious legal repercussions, as driving without a functioning speedometer may result in unintentional speeding, which can incur fines or even jeopardize your driving privileges. Moreover, the safety implications are significant; without accurate speed readings, you may struggle to maintain a safe distance from other vehicles, increasing the risk of accidents. Additionally, a malfunctioning speedometer can indicate deeper mechanical problems that could compromise your vehicle's overall performance, potentially leading to more costly repairs down the line. Lastly, for those considering resale, a non-functioning speedometer can detract from your vehicle's value, as prospective buyers may view it as a sign of neglect. Therefore, it is crucial to prioritize the repair of your speedometer to ensure compliance with the law, safeguard your driving experience, and protect your investment.
